Qualified people on parole are eligible for food stamps and cash aid (also called EBT and General Relief) It is very little money and just enough food stamps to avoid starvation. There are also programs which provide tax breaks and other incentives to companies who hire people on parole. These entitlement programs are meant to promote rehabilitation of a convicted felon...an unemployed, broke and hungry felon is statistically far more prone to recidivism. So, YES, entitlement programs are available to ex-felons.
